» CHAPTER NINE «
We returned to the car and Brian told me to get in the backseat. He grabbed a blanket and laid it across me. "Thank you," I said when we pulled away.
"Go to sleep, we have a long ride home plus I have to grab something," he planned out loud.
I nodded off. In my dream, I was in the same park. Near the dock, in the water, was a figure swimming. It was a hot, steamy day. I walked on the deck. The man sat of the edge. I approached him and I bent down and kissed him. But couldn't see the face. I wanted to see his face so bad.
I woke up with a start.
"Bad dream?" Brian asked, his eyes looked at me through his rear view mirror.
"I'm not sure." My vision was blurred and I couldn't see anything. "We almost home?"
He nodded. "You any better?" I told him I was much warmer. I looked at him. He was apparently freezing.
"Pull over," I commanded him. He did. "Get out of the car." He did that too. I took off the blanket and put it on him. I rubbed him.
"My lips are numb," he informed. I put my finger on his lips. They were icy cold. I pulled his hands to his mouth, but they were turning white.
"They're like blocks of ice," I commented. We needed to get them warm. Fast. I only thought of one thing.
"Get in the back for a second," I instructed again. He got in and I followed. "Okay, this is gonna sound crazy and perverted, but put your hands on my back." He put them reluctantly on my back. "No, under my shirt," I pointed out, "It's sounds sick, but my back is giving off loads of heat and you need some fast."
He slid his large hands under my shirt. I shivered slightly. But I didn't know why. He was nervous, I could tell, because he couldn't figure out a spot to keep his hands. They got warmer and I took them out. I got into the front and drove the rest of the way to my place.
